What is a Cryptocurrency wallet, and how it works?

In the previous part, we used a real-world example to explain crypto wallets. But the world of digital currencies and blockchain technology are slightly different. In this world, cryptocurrencies cannot be stored in physical wallets, because they themselves do not exist physically. Instead, Blackchain holds a trading history that accurately indicates which public and private keys control capital and financial resources.
To make sure you understand this mechanism, we explain the followings separately: the wallet addresses, public keys and private keys.
1. Wallet address
A wallet address is the same as a bank account number. As you know, there is no harm in giving your bank account number to other people. They need it to send you money.
Similarly, in the world of cryptocurrencies, if anyone wants to send you money, they must have your address.
Just like in the real world, there are no two wallets with same addresses, so there will be no chance of sending money to anyone else other than you. You can Also have as many addresses as you want and there are no restrictions.
Bitcoin wallet address
Take a look at the following wallet address to see what the address of a cryptocurrency like Bitcoin looks like. They say that this address belongs to, Satoshi Nakamoto, the creator of Bitcoin!
1A1zP1eP5QGefi2DMPTfTL5SLmv7DivfNa
As you can see, this address has both uppercase and lowercase letters. Since blockchain is transparent, you can easily access it. Find out how much money is held in it or what transactions have been made with it before.
It should be noted, however, that the address of the wallet does not disclose the real name of the owner and its original identity. This is why Blackchain is referred to as “ pseudonymous” .
How do public and private keys relate to wallet address?
Now that you have seen the similarity between an address of a wallet and a bank account number, let’s look at how a person can control their own money and account. Usually people think that the public key of a wallet is its address, while it is not!
let’s start with the private key.
1. Private Key
Basically Every wallet has a public key and a private key. The private key allows the owner to take control of their money and accounts. remember that wallet addresses are unique and no two different wallets have the same addresses
For example, in the real world, you need to use your personal password to transfer money from your bank account to another account. No one else knows this password, even the bank where you keep your money in. Obviously, if anyone knows this password they can transfer the money from your account to their accounts!
2. Public key
A public key also has a similar function and specifically belongs to a unique wallet address. But what is the use of a public key? A public key relates to a wallet address through a mathematical formula (one-way function). This key is a “hash version” as described below.
A hash function is a function that receives a sequence or series of numbers and letters (called input) and delivers a new sequence or series of numbers and letters (called output). In this way, there is a Public key for each wallet address which will turn into the wallet address by the hash function.
This function is one-way, meaning that it has no inverse function and we cannot convert the address to its public key. Doing so secures your wallets and assures you that your wallet can’t be hacked. Below is a simple example.
